Lorenzo Musetti vs. Laslo Djere Rolex Paris Masters

Lorenzo Musetti vs. Laslo Djere

Head to head 3-0 for Djere

Lorenzo Musetti will compete against Laslo Djere in the 1st round for the 4th time of their career. They are scheduled to compete on Monday at 9:00 pm on COURT 1.

Lorenzo Musetti: ranking and results

Ranked no. 67, Lorenzo got to the 1st round after defeating Lucas Pouille 4-6 6-4 6-1.

The Italian has a 34-28 win-loss record in 2021, 8-7 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S). The Italian’s best result of the season was reaching the final in the Antalya Challenger and the Biella 2 Challenger.

Last year in Paris The Italian didn’t compete in Paris in 2020.

Laslo Djere: ranking and results

Ranked no. 52, the Serbian will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in St Petersburg where he lost 6-3 6-2 to Ivashka in the 1st round on the 26th of October.

Djere has a 23-26 win-loss record in 2021, 3-4 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

The Serbian’s best result of the year was getting to the final in Cagliari.

Last year in Paris The Serbian reached the 1st round last year in Paris before retiring against Kevin Anderson.

Head to head analysis

This will be the 4th time that Lorenzo Musetti and Laslo Djere clash against each other. Their current record is 3-0 for Djere (see full H2H stats), 1-0 on indoor hard courts.

Previously, the last time when they squared off, Djere won 6-4 6-7(3) 6-4 in the 2nd round in Nur sultan back in September 2021.

Sebastian Korda vs. Aslan Karatsev Rolex Paris Masters

Sebastian Korda vs. Aslan Karatsev

Head to head 2-0 for Korda

Sebastian Korda will square off with Aslan Karatsev in the 1st round for the 3rd time of their career. They are scheduled to play on Monday at 1:30 pm on COURT 1.

Sebastian Korda: ranking and results

Ranked no. 38 (career high), the American will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in St Petersburg where he lost 6-2 7-5 to Van De Zandschulp in the 2nd round on the 28th of October.

Korda has a 30-18 win-loss record in 2021, 7-3 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

His best result of the season was conquering the title the Quimper Challenger where he defeated Filip Horansky in the final 6-1 6-1 and in Parma where he defeated Marco Cecchinato in the final 6-2 6-4.

Last year in Paris Sebastian didn’t compete in Paris in 2020.

Aslan Karatsev: ranking and results

Ranked no. 19 (career high), Karatsev will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in St Petersburg where he lost 6-3 6-2 to Millman in the 2nd round on the 28th of October.

The Russian has a 37-19 win-loss record in 2021, 4-2 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

His best result of the season was winning the title in Dubai where he defeated Lloyd Harris in the final 6-3 6-2 and in Moscow where he beat Marin Cilic in the final 6-2 6-4.

Last year in Paris The Russian didn’t play in Paris in 2020.

Head to head analysis

This will be the 3rd time that Sebastian Korda and Aslan Karatsev square off. Their head to head is 2-0 for Korda (see full H2H stats), but they have never competed against each other on indoor hard courts.

Previously, the last time they locked horns, Korda won 6-3 6-0 in the 3rd round in Miami back in March 2021.

Mackenzie Mcdonald vs. Dusan Lajovic Rolex Paris Masters

Mackenzie Mcdonald vs. Dusan Lajovic

Head to head 1-0 for Mcdonald

Mackenzie Mcdonald will come up against Dusan Lajovic in the 1st round for the 2nd time of their career. They are scheduled to compete on Monday at 11:00 am on COURT 1.

Mackenzie Mcdonald: ranking and results

Ranked no. 56, Mackenzie will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in St Petersburg where he lost 6-3 6-2 to Bautista-Agut in the 2nd round on the 28th of October.

Mackenzie has a 42-24 win-loss record in 2021, 9-4 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

Mackenzie’s best result of the season was reaching the final in the Sultan 1 Challenger and Washington.

Last year in Paris Mcdonald didn’t play in Paris in 2020.

Dusan Lajovic: ranking and results

Ranked no. 33, Lajovic will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in Vienna where he lost 6-4 6-4 to Tiafoe in the 1st round on the 26th of October.

Lajovic has a 16-26 win-loss record in 2021, 2-5 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

Last year in Paris The Serbian lost in the 1st round 7-6(5) 6-3 to Adrian Mannarino.

Head to head analysis

This will be the 2nd time that Mackenzie Mcdonald and Dusan Lajovic fight against each other. Their current record is 1-0 for Mcdonald (see full H2H stats), but they have never competed against each other on indoor hard courts.

Previously, the last time when they fought against each other, Mcdonald won 6-4 6-4 in the 1st round in Munich back in April 2021.

Alexander Bublik vs. Daniel Evans Rolex Paris Masters

Alexander Bublik vs. Daniel Evans

Head to head 2-1 for Bublik

Alexander Bublik will play Daniel Evans in the 1st round for the 4th time of their career. They are scheduled to play on Monday at 4:00 pm on COURT 1.

Alexander Bublik: ranking and results

Ranked no. 34 (career high), the Kazakhstani will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in St Petersburg where he lost 6-4 6-3 to Struff in the 2nd round on the 27th of October.

Bublik has a 32-27 win-loss record in 2021, 7-5 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

Alexander’s best result of the current season was getting to the final in Antalya and Singapore.

Last year in Paris Bublik lost in the 1st round 6-1 6-4 to Lorenzo Sonego.

Daniel Evans: ranking and results

Ranked no. 24, the Brit will start his run in Paris after he played his last match in Vienna where he lost 6-4 6-3 to Alcaraz in the 1st round on the 25th of October.

Evans has a 24-21 win-loss record in 2021, 0-1 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).

His best result of the current season was winning the title in Melbourne where he defeated Felix Auger Aliassime in the final 6-2 6-3.

Last year in Paris The Brit capitulated in the 1st round 6-3 7-6(3) to Stan Wawrinka.

Head to head analysis

This will be the 4th time that Alexander Bublik and Daniel Evans fight against each other. Their actual record is 2-1 for Bublik (see full H2H stats), but they have never played each other on indoor hard courts.

The last time they locked horns, Bublik won 6-4 6-4 in the 1st round in Toronto back in August 2021.
